Fawad Khan Goes Down On One Knee For Deepika At IIFA 2016

Darpan News Desk IANS, 27 Jun, 2016 12:11 PM
    All it takes is Fawad's charm and Deepika's beauty to stir up a storm and that is exactly what happened at the IIFA Rocks 2016.
     
    Deepika was an absolute stunner in her black gown, but what got our hearts racing was Fawad going down on one knee for the Mastani.
     
    But would you believe she went down on one knee for the Pakistani heartthrob before he had a chance to? He also joked and called her his ticket to Hollywood and tried to charm her with the lyrics of Roop Tera Mastana.

    His charm seemed to work. He got a hug from the beautiful actress and he could hardly contain his excitement.
